Classifying subgroups of chronic low back pain patients based on lifting patterns

Summary
Classifying chronic lower back pain (CLBP) patients by lifting patterns revealed distinct subgroups. Those with different lifting styles reported worse pain and lower self-efficacy, highlighting the importance of physical function in CLBP classification.

Background:
- Chronic lower back pain (CLBP) affects a significant portion of the population.
- Lifting patterns may influence pain perception and disability in CLBP patients.
- Current classification systems for CLBP may not fully capture functional differences.
Purpose of the Study:
- To compare self-reported measures between CLBP patients classified into subgroups based on lifting patterns.
- To investigate the relationship between distinct lifting mechanics and pain/psychosocial outcomes in CLBP.
Main Methods:
- A cross-sectional study was conducted in a research laboratory setting.
- Participants included 81 individuals with CLBP and 53 pain-free controls.
- Lifting patterns during a repetitive task were assessed, alongside self-reported disability, pain intensity, and psychosocial factors.
Main Results:
- Two distinct CLBP subgroups emerged: one lifting similarly to controls (n=35) and another lifting significantly differently (n=46).
- The CLBP subgroup with different lifting patterns reported significantly higher pain intensity (P=.005) and pain severity (P=.025).
- This subgroup also exhibited significantly lower self-efficacy (P=.013) compared to the CLBP subgroup with similar lifting patterns.
Conclusions:
- A classification system utilizing lifting patterns successfully identified two distinct CLBP subgroups.
- These subgroups differed significantly in both their physical lifting behaviors and self-reported outcomes.
- The findings underscore the critical role of incorporating physical functioning measures into CLBP classification systems.
